Comprehending Registered Agent Services

A registered agent serves as a essential link between a company and the government entities. This individual or company is designated to receive important legal notices, such as court summons, state communications, and relevant documents. By having a designated representative, companies ensure that they stay updated about their legal obligations, allowing for prompt responses to any matters that may arise.

Registered agent requirements can change based on the state in which the company operates. Typically, the designated representative must have a physical address within the region and be on call during operating hours to handle documents. This is crucial for upholding regulations and avoiding legal issues. Many companies choose to engage a certified agent to meet these requirements effectively.

Moreover, registered agent services provide a level of confidentiality for business owners. By using a designated representative, personal location details can be kept confidential, as the agent's contact will be listed on official documents. This not only preserves the owner's confidentiality but also helps in cultivating a reputable appearance for the business. Registered Agent Obligations and Standards

Registered agent requirements change depending on the state, and it is essential for organizations to understand and follow these standards. Typically, a registered agent must be a resident of the state or a corporation authorized to conduct business there. They must also have a real address, known as the designated office, where legal documents and formal communication can be sent during regular business hours. This in-person presence ensures that crucial legal notifications are timely received.

In addition to geographical requirements, some states set specific criteria on registered agents. For example, registered agents can be individuals or professional entities, and they must have the capability to receive legal documents. Cost of Registered Agent Services

When thinking about the services of a registered agent, grasping the costs are essential to companies. Costs for registered agent services may vary greatly depending on the specific provider and the services included. On average, businesses can anticipate to spend anywhere from $100 to $300 annually for a basic registered agent service. Nonetheless, some registered agent companies could provide premium packages with extra features, that could increase the overall cost.

It is important to assess what each registered agent provider offers within their pricing structure. Some may offer benefits like annual compliance reminders, document handling, or even virtual office services in their fees. Evaluating these options can help not only help identify the most affordable registered agent but also make certain that your business receives the necessary services to ensure compliance and legal protection.

Additionally, companies should take into account any potential additional costs which may come up, such as fees for document filing and changes to registered agent details. Understanding these additional charges upfront will help budgeting and avoiding unexpected expenses in the long run.
